The Pulse of Canada's Saw Blade Industry

Canada’s industrial landscape, stretching from the temperate rainforests of British Columbia to the manufacturing hubs of Ontario, demands a diverse and robust supply of high-performance saw blades. As a premier saw blades factory partner for the Canadian market, we recognize that "Made for Canada" means engineered for precision, durability, and extreme weather resilience.

The Canadian saw blade market is currently undergoing a massive transformation. With the rise of the "Green Building" movement in Vancouver and Toronto, there is an unprecedented demand for specialized TCT (Tungsten Carbide Tipped) blades that can handle cross-laminated timber (CLT) and other engineered wood products. Furthermore, the metalworking sector in the Prairies requires high-speed steel (HSS) solutions that maintain their temper during the rigorous demands of oil and gas equipment fabrication.

Local Trend Insight: Current data indicates a 15% year-over-year increase in the adoption of Polycrystalline Diamond (PCD) tipped blades in Canadian furniture manufacturing due to their superior lifespan in high-volume production environments.

Precision in the Great White North

In the Canadian forestry sector, particularly in British Columbia, the accuracy of a saw blade can mean the difference between high-value export timber and waste. Our saw blades factory utilizes AI-optimized tooth geometry to reduce kerf loss, which directly translates to higher yields for Canadian mills.

For the construction industry in Ontario and Quebec, our blades are engineered to withstand "Cold-Start" stresses. Steel and carbide behave differently at -20°C; our proprietary heat treatment ensures that the tension in the circular saw blade remains stable even during the harshest Canadian winters.

🇨🇦 Canadian Application Scenarios

B.C. Forestry & Timber

High-diameter TCT blades designed for the massive Douglas Fir and Western Red Cedar mills. Low noise and vibration-damping slots are standard for Canadian safety compliance.

Ontario Auto-Manufacturing

High-Speed Steel annular cutters and metal drill bits optimized for the multi-material assembly lines in Southern Ontario's automotive corridor.

Arctic Infrastructure

Specialized diamond tools and hole saws designed to work through frozen substrate and reinforced concrete in Northern Canadian territory projects.
